USB Flash Drive not detected...
Hi, I've googled and tried plenty of different ways to fix this problem, but so far nothing...so I'm hoping for another answer...
I have a 2.5GB Seagate flash drive that has been working properly over the last 2-3 years, last night I used it to save some folders because I was reformating my computer. I've plugged it into at least 3 different computers and none of them can detect it. I hear the little beeping sound when it gets plugged in and when I take it out, the light even flashes when it gets plugged it. But when I go to My Computer it's no where to be found. I checked the Device Manager and it has the yellow !, I've uninstalled and installed the drive, My Computer>Manage>Disk Management, etc, but nothing helped....has it died on me already?
